Output 435869a84ba9f356b80fb081b24e2e46d88e084c53f4df62f717255429150bce:123
- value
- 584377
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0e504758a4d9b7238ffcf29f3c98c05ca4534706 OP_EQUAL
- address
- 32zhZ6ELcGTnWAekKEAK3YW88LAwj4CCWX
- transaction
- 435869a84ba9f356b80fb081b24e2e46d88e084c53f4df62f717255429150bce
- confirmations
- 182042
- spent
- true